NBA Game Summary - Denver at Utah 10.29.2005
|
Salt Lake City, UT (Basketball News) - Carmelo Anthony scored a game-high 21 points and grabbed six rebounds to lead the Denver Nuggets over the Utah Jazz, 89-83, at the Delta Center in the preseason finale for both clubs.
Anthony, who had the fourth-year option of his contract picked up by the Nuggets earlier in the day, shot 7-of-13 from the floor in 29 minutes of action.
Voshon Lenard ended with 16 points and seven rebounds for Denver, which won the final seven games of its exhibition schedule to finished the preseason 7-1. Andre Miller added 15 points, six rebounds and five assists for the Nuggets, who open the regular season on Tuesday at San Antonio.
Mehmet Okur had 17 points for the Jazz, who ended the preseason 2-5 and open the regular season on Wednesday at home against Dallas.
Rookie first-round pick Deron Williams added 12 points and seven assists for Utah.
